Types of Betting Odds Explained

There are several formats through which betting odds can be represented, including decimal, fractional, and moneyline. Understanding these formats is crucial for analyzing wagers:

  • Decimal Odds: Commonly used in Europe, decimal odds indicate how much a player will win for every dollar wagered. For instance, odds of 2.50 imply that a $100 bet would return $250 if successful.
  • Fractional Odds: Predominant in the UK, these odds show the profit relative to the stake. For example, odds of 5/1 mean that for every $1 wagered, a bettor will win $5.
  • Moneyline Odds: Common in the US, these odds can be positive or negative, indicating how much a bettor can win on a $100 wager or how much one must stake to win $100, respectively.

Reading and Interpreting Betting Lines

Betting lines are formulated based on various statistical models that assess risk for the bookmaker. Reading these lines requires an understanding of what they represent in terms of probability. For instance, if a team showcases a -200 moneyline, it signifies that they are favored and that a bettor must wager $200 to win $100. Conversely, a +150 line indicates that a $100 wager can yield $150 in profit.

Identifying Value Bets in Sports Betting

A value bet occurs when the implied probability of an outcome is less than the actual likelihood of that outcome occurring. Successful bettors are adept at spotting these opportunities. One effective strategy is to calculate the implied odds based on betting lines and compare them with your analysis of the event’s probabilities.

Bankroll Management: Staying in the Game

A fundamental aspect of gambling is bankroll management. Establishing clear limits for wins and losses ensures that you remain in control. A common approach is the 1% rule, where a bettor wagers only 1% of their total bankroll on any single bet, which mitigates the risk of significant losses.

Implementing the Kelly Criterion

The Kelly Criterion is a mathematical formula that optimally determines bet size based on the probability of winning versus the odds received. This strategy aims to maximize your bankroll growth while managing risk. While it can be complex, a basic understanding can enhance decision-making in betting scenarios.

Chasing Losses: A Dangerous Habit

Chasing losses is a common mistake wherein bettors attempt to recoup losses by increasing the sizes of their bets. This approach can lead to substantial financial risk and can exacerbate losses. Instead of chasing, bettors should accept losses as part of the game and stick to their strategies.

Overvaluing Expert Opinions and Tips

While expert opinions can be informative, relying solely on them to make betting decisions can be detrimental. It’s essential to combine expert advice with personal research and analysis, ensuring that decisions are well-informed.

Failing to Manage Betting Emotions

Emotions can cloud judgment and lead to poor decisions while betting. Establishing emotional boundaries, setting strict limits, and taking breaks can help maintain composure during both winning and losing streaks.
